Prachanda marks milestone: One year as PM, breaking his previous records



KATHMANDU: Prime Minister Pushpa Kamal Dahal ‘Prachanda’ has achieved a significant milestone, surpassing his own records, as his tenure as the Prime Minister of Nepal completes one year.

Prachanda, who has served as Prime Minister three times, has now successfully held the position for a year for the first time in his political career. Previously, his terms were limited to nine months on two occasions.

His current term began on Poush 11, 2079 BS, and to commemorate this achievement, Prachanda is scheduled to address the nation today.

Prachanda’s political journey includes his first election as Prime Minister on Shrawan 31, 2065 BS, where the CPN (Maoist Center) emerged as the largest party in the constitutional assembly election.

For his second term, he was elected on Shrawan 19, 2073 BS, with the support of Nepali Congress, leading to the overthrow of the government led by KP Sharma Oli, Chairman of CPN-UML.
